Digital Mayflies: Transient Personhood of AI Companions

2026-05-27

Abstract excerpt

This paper examines the ontological and ethical status of Generative AI companions through a revised Minimal Viable Person (MVP) framework. Rather than residing within the foundational large language model or the post-training assistant persona, AI companions emerge as ontically distinct, roleplayed characters within specific conversational threads.
